• Place a .354 (small diameter) cap nut on a flat surface,

inside up.

• Fit the end of the fork axle into the cap nut.

• Tap the opposite end of the fork axle with a hammer to

secure the cap nut on the axle. Pull on the cap nut to
make sure it is securely assembled.
